No trains will run over a number of weekends.
A £3.5m refurbishment of the 134 year old railway viaduct in Ashurst is about to get underway, with three weekends of engineering work planned for this summer - starting this weekend.
No trains will run on the following dates:
- Saturday 2 and Sunday 3 July
- Saturday 9 and Sunday 10 July
- Saturday 6 and Sunday 7 August
Buses will be replacing trains between Uckfield and Crowborough, and between Crowborough and Oxted.
